Woman charged after allegedly spitting on cops

Some St. Thomas police officers got more than they might have expected when they tried to arrest an intoxicated woman.

Police were called to a home on Miller Street around 2 a.m. Friday to remove an unwanted person. When they arrived, they found an intoxicated woman who was refusing to leave. As they tried to arrest her, police say she screamed at, kicked, and spit upon the officers.

The 21-year-old woman was taken into custody and is now charged with resisting arrest and assaulting police.

She was released with a future court date.
